You will be working for a successful and award winning, owner-managed Garden Landscaping company with a proven track record in building and maintaining garden projects from the smallest domestic schemes to the largest private gardens. This is an opportunity to progress your career working on acclaimed, award winning gardens.

The Garden Maintenance Teams are based from the office and yard near Chertsey, Surrey and gardens are located throughout Central London, Surrey and the surrounding areas. The sites are a very broad mix of high-end domestic gardens, many of which have been designed and built by the company. You will ensure that they look their best as they continue to develop and mature.

The work is a mix of:

  • Lawn care (mowing, feeding etc.)
  • Tending to borders and containers (feeding, staking, weeding, planting)
  • General and specialised pruning, using hand and power tools
  • General watering and management of irrigation systems
  • Application of chemical and biological control
  • Management of garden water features
  • Ground and hard surface clearance
  • Soil management (testing pH and moisture levels, mulching and improving)

You will have a reasonable knowledge of gardening practices and will probably have a RHS qualification to Level 2. As a Team Leader you will often be “the face of the company” with both clients and their representatives and should therefore have a pleasant, friendly manner and good communication skills.

You will ensure that you and your team have the correct uniform and PPE and that the vehicles and machinery that you use are in good order and safe to operate. You will maintain your tools correctly to ensure their serviceability. You will ensure that stock and materials are available for each job/site on a daily basis and submit requests for additional items. You will allocate duties to your team, audit the work that is done and report progress jobs completed on a daily basis.

The Person:

Ideally you will have at least 3 years’ experience of leading a small team in a gardening role together with a landscaping or gardening qualification. A Driving Licence is ESSENTIAL.

These attributes would be useful but should not stop you applying for the roles:

  • RHS Level 2 - Horticulture (or a suitable equivalent)
  • PA1 & PA6 certificate
  • CS30 & CS31
  • Trailer licence / experience
